Computer Hardware in Tabor, IA

Refine
Sort by
Features

1. Hometown Computers

Hometown Computers

1106 Central Ave, Nebraska City, NE 68410

CLOSED NOW:8:30 am - 6:00 pm

From Business: For all your computing and communication needs

YP
11 Years
in Business